Output 8c28eff03009f496b91a9a505749f1c9f7e604c66f39a65eeb45eb9f8f04614b:0

value
324319000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b38f5cb26a8aea8d8c4dd76578a899f8e768c3 OP_EQUAL
address
MReeRhAn7zRfWaJLncvQCN2ziZyLynQJz5
transaction
8c28eff03009f496b91a9a505749f1c9f7e604c66f39a65eeb45eb9f8f04614b
spent
true